summ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Serhiy Storchaka <storchaka@gmail.com>2016-05-11 19:19:49 (GMT)
committerSerhiy Storchaka <storchaka@gmail.com>2016-05-11 19:19:49 (GMT)
commitec5d54575f176b0c198db4cd7aa306fb69152088 (patch)
tree0629421d8dfa8e673f0e6ece395ba89307d37f0b
parent3414e4a34ffc14a57e717a445b8ca5dcd00208cf (diff)
downloadcpython-ec5d54575f176b0c198db4cd7aa306fb69152088.zip
cpython-ec5d54575f176b0c198db4cd7aa306fb69152088.tar.gz
cpython-ec5d54575f176b0c198db4cd7aa306fb69152088.tar.bz2
Issue #26881: Restored the name of scan_opcodes_25().
It is better to not change this in bugfix release.
-rw-r--r--Lib/modulefinder.py5
1 files changed, 3 insertions, 2 deletions
diff --git a/Lib/modulefinder.py b/Lib/modulefinder.py
index b8cce1f..8103502 100644
--- a/Lib/modulefinder.py
+++ b/Lib/modulefinder.py
@@ -336,7 +336,8 @@ class ModuleFinder:
fullname = name + "." + sub
self._add_badmodule(fullname, caller)
- def scan_opcodes(self, co):
+ def scan_opcodes_25(self, co,
+ unpack = struct.unpack):
# Scan the code, and yield 'interesting' opcode combinations
code = co.co_code
names = co.co_names
@@ -359,7 +360,7 @@ class ModuleFinder:
def scan_code(self, co, m):
code = co.co_code
- scanner = self.scan_opcodes
+ scanner = self.scan_opcodes_25
for what, args in scanner(co):
if what == "store":
name, = args